PHP架构设计:弹性云计算资源动态分配策略
|
在现代Web应用开发中,PHP作为主流后端语言之一,其架构设计需要兼顾性能、可扩展性和成本效益。随着业务需求的波动,传统的静态资源分配方式已难以满足实际需求,因此引入弹性云计算资源动态分配策略显得尤为重要。
2026AI分析图,仅供参考 弹性云计算资源动态分配的核心在于根据实时负载情况自动调整计算资源。例如,在流量高峰时段,系统可以自动扩展服务器实例数量,以应对突发的请求压力;而在低谷期,则减少资源使用,从而降低运营成本。 实现这一策略的关键在于监控和自动化。通过部署监控工具,可以实时获取CPU、内存、网络等指标,结合预设的阈值触发资源扩缩容操作。同时,采用容器化技术如Docker和Kubernetes,能够更灵活地管理应用实例,提升资源利用率。 PHP应用的架构设计也需要适应这种动态变化。例如,使用无状态服务设计,确保每个请求都可以被任意服务器处理,避免因资源变化导致的会话丢失问题。同时,引入缓存机制和异步任务队列,有助于减轻服务器负担,提高整体响应效率。 最终,合理的弹性资源配置不仅提升了系统的可靠性和用户体验,还有效控制了云服务成本。通过持续优化监控策略和资源调度算法,企业可以在保证服务质量的同时,实现更高效的资源利用。 (编辑:站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

